A video has been circulating on the social media platform TikTok of an Arkansas man stealing from a farm stand on various occasions. You can see the man walking up to the stand with a friend on one occasion and quite literally saying, “I’ll rip their [expletive] cash box, bro.”
In various other clips, he can be seen returning to the farm stand multiple times, even on the same day, to grab things without paying. Commenters rushed to the replies to share their opinion on the situation, with many condemning the man for his actions.
In this particular video, the original poster explains that she and her family are working with law enforcement and posted about it on their community page. Before that, she had allegedly spoken with the man, whose name was revealed to be Kenyion Lewing, on various occasions on Facebook, as evidenced in a different video.
In one response given concerning paying for the items via CashApp, he wrote, “Oh shoot. Yes maam we were he sent me back several times lol. I used cash for the first one. I’ll come by shortly with some cash I hate that app stuff.
According to the caption of the video sharing Facebook messages, it is written, “When we posted his picture on Facebook, his uncles came by to pay some of what he owed. we even told him he could come back to the farm stand as long as he made sure to pay for everything he took. When he finally did return back, he made multiple stops and only paid for some of the things he took. we private messaged him about it, and he said he would come by and pay for everything but still has not done so, and he keeps coming and getting more items without paying..
However, it is confirmed that he did end up paying, as written in the caption of the video above.
